How much do sugar factory j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 23, 2026, the average hourly pay for sugar factory in Texas is $15.71,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$14.33 and $16.78 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a sugar factory?

A Sugar Factory job typically involves roles in production, packaging, quality control, and machinery operation within a sugar manufacturing facility. Workers may be responsible for processing raw sugar, refining it, and preparing it for distribution. Some positions require technical skills, while others involve manual labor. Safety and hygiene are essential in these environments.

What does a typical workday look like for an employee in a sugar factory?

A typical day in a sugar factory often involves monitoring and operating processing equipment, inspecting raw materials, conducting quality checks, and performing routine maintenance. Employees usually work as part of a larger production team, ensuring the smooth flow of operations and quickly addressing any technical issues that arise. Shifts can be structured due to the continuous nature of production, offering the opportunity to work days, nights, or weekends depending on the factory schedule. Collaboration with supervisors, quality assurance staff, and maintenance crews is common. You'll find the work both fast-paced and structured, with clear responsibilities to ensure the factory meets production and safety standards.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in the sugar factory position, and why are they important?

To thrive in a Sugar Factory role, candidates typically need strong mechanical aptitude, attention to detail, and basic knowledge of food safety and industrial processes, often supported by a high school diploma or vocational training. Familiarity with automated processing equipment, quality control systems, and HACCP (Hazard Analysis and Critical Control Points) certification is highly beneficial. Teamwork, problem-solving abilities, and communication skills help individuals excel within busy, collaborative environments. These skills and qualifications are essential to ensure efficiency, product quality, and safety in the manufacturing process.
